Hi,

during old joomla content import I received following error:

Fatal error: Maximum execution time of 30 seconds exceeded in /.../public_html/libraries/joomla/utilities/arrayhelper.php on line 163

I have some content to import (more or less 1000 articules, no images at all, largest category contain 4000 articles).

My ecosystem is: Joomla 1.5.23 (updated from initial 1.5.15)  / PHP 5.2.14 / Mysql 5.0.90-community.

Even I tried to archive part of old Joomla content; then import; then unarchive and archieve another part import and so on. But in Joomla! you can only archieve articules not categories, and it seems that even importing categories without any article takes a lot of time.

What advice? Any dimensioning? Any trick?

BTW:

Of course I have no access to php.ini to upper max_execution_time.- this is standard hosting not XAMP instalation.
